http://findarticles.com/p/articles/mi_m1355/is_9_103/ai_98079631However, the MJ show was over-shadowed by a controversial foul by Indiana's Jermaine O'Neal that put Lakers' Kobe Bryant on the line. Bryant made two of his three free throws to force a second overtime, and the Timberwolves' Kevin Garnett's dominating performance gave the West a 155-145 victory over the East in double overtime, the first in All-Star history
